Unlock Star Wars wallpapers, theme and clock on op5t 6 or 8gb ram

Hi,
I'm sharing this to start a conversation about the user experience.
The unlocking process works on both version of the op5t.
Here is the link (https://www.xda-developers.com/offi...ers-oneplus-5t/amp/?__twitter_impression=true) for the process on oos 4.7.2 non-root.
If you're on oos 4.7.4 or 4.7.5 non-root you can use the method of CareDood by downgrading:
How to do it without twrp/root with completely stock 4.7.5 phone. No data lost.
Download full 4.7.2 zip from:
http://otafsg1.h2os.com/patch/amazon...7ca8ad1c7d.zip
Dirtyflash it via stock oneplus recovery. Boot up in 4.7.2, throw in the magical indian model dialer code *#*#9339#*#* and reboot. Then just grab the ota back to 4.7.5. and be a happy camper. Running the starwars theme on stock 4.7.5 now.
You can revert by doing the same thing, just using dialer code *#*#3392#*#* , but you will lose the theme.
I personaly don't know if it's working on other stock version so just read the post from other people.
If your op5t is rooted, download the file from lupick. The flash has to be done on bluespark recovery.
If you want to go back to op5t original, do this share by panart,
Download the 'starwars_enable.zip' file from lupick, open it, go to 'sys/module/param_read_write/parameters', extract 'cust_flag', open it with a text editor (e.g. Notepad++) and change the value from '2' to '0', save the file (without an extension), replace the original 'cust_flag' file in 'starwars_enable.zip' and flash it in TWRP.
You can also flash the zip file "star wars_disable".

See here, https://forum.xda-developers.com/oneplus-5t/how-to/official-oxygenos-4-7-2-7-1-1-ota-t3709265
Read the 3rd post For Rooted Users with TWRP Recovery
PS: Do not*flash*partial update OTAs (under 1*GB) on a modifieddevice! If you want to use partial OTAs, you must first*flash*a full OTA that it applies to, and then*flash*the partial OTA from stock recovery. Flashing partial OTAs from TWRP will either fail or soft brick your*device. You can return to a usable state by flashing one of the above full OTA zips in recovery.
